4 How the SC-325 & SC-650 Controllers Communicate with the
RollSeal RS-500/600 Door.
Inside the upper right housing of the RollSeal RS-500/600 Door is an Encoder that sends electrical pulses to the
SC-325 & SC-650 Controllers. When the door is moving, the Controller is in normal operating mode. (See Section
20 or Manual #4801-5156 for wiring diagram of the Encoder). The SC-325 & SC-650 Controllers refer to the
position of the door in units of “Counts”, which is based upon the number of encoded pulses that the Encoder sends
to the Controller.
NOTE: The term Position Units is used throughout this document and refers to the position of the
door in units of Counts.
A Count of zero is assigned to the full open position where the Home Switch operates, and the highest count is
assigned to the full closed position. The maximum number of Counts that the SC-325 & SC-650 will read depend
upon the particular installation. In general, a Count is approximately equal to 1/8 inch of door movement. Several
of the parameters of the SC-325 & SC-650 are displayed in units of Counts, such as the Actual Position, the Open
and Closed Limit Positions and the Acceleration and Deceleration Ranges.
